Janus,
Thank you for your bug report and helping to make Ubuntu better. The capabilities mismatch is fixed a lot of times by updating your client. You can do that by opening a Terminal (Applications > Accesories > Terminal) and running the following command.

sudo add-apt-repository ppa:ubuntuone/stable && sudo apt-get update && sudo apt-get upgrade

Let us know how that goes.
